CC -!- FUNCTION: Thrombin, which cleaves bonds after Arg and Lys, converts
CC fibrinogen to fibrin and activates factors V, VII, VIII, XIII, and, in
CC complex with thrombomodulin, protein C. Functions in blood homeostasis,
CC inflammation and wound healing. {ECO:0000256|ARBA:ARBA00025390}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=Selective cleavage of Arg-|-Gly bonds in fibrinogen to form
CC fibrin and release fibrinopeptides A and B.; EC=3.4.21.5;
CC Evidence={ECO:0000256|ARBA:ARBA00001621};
